Abbesses is an underground station of the Paris Métro in the 18th arrondissement of Paris under the Butte Montmartre . The name of the station translates as "Abbesses" and comes from the "Place des Abbesses" (Eng. Place of the Abbesses). He refers to the Benedictine nuns - Abbey in Montmartre in the 12th century by King Louis VI. was founded and served as the first abbess of Ludwig's wife Adelheid of Savoy .
The station is served by Métrolinie 12 . It lies around 36 meters below the surface of the earth, which makes it the lowest station in the Métronetz.
The station went into operation on October 31, 1912 when the northern extension of Line A from Pigalle to Jules Joffrin station was opened. On March 27, 1931, line A was renamed line 12. In 2006 and 2007 the station was completely renovated.
In Abbesses you can change trains to the Funiculaire de Montmartre and the Montmartrobus .
In 2011 the number of passengers was 2,545,127.
architecture
The underground station is equipped with two side platforms in a vault . Two spiral staircases and two elevators lead from an intermediate level south of the platforms to the access level ( Salle des billets ) below the Place des Abbesses , on the eastern edge of which is the only entrance.
The covered staircase was designed in the Art Nouveau style based on plans by Hector Guimard and is a popular photo motif. Originally for receipt Metro Station de Ville Hôtel in the Rue de Lobau built, the roof was moved in 1974 from its former location on the Montmartre. Today it is one of the two existing canopies of this type; the other is located at the station Porte Dauphine of Line 2 .
